📌 Grammar Summary: The Big Contrast

Present Simple: Habits, general truths, and permanent states.
Keywords: usually, every day, often, always, rarely.

Present Continuous: Actions in progress NOW or temporary situations.
Keywords: now, at the moment, today, right now, Look!

⚠️ Remember: Stative verbs like know, believe, understand, love, want usually stay in **Simple** even if the action is happening now.

📖 Reading: A Mission in Kenya

My name is Sarah and I usually live in London, where I work as a nurse in a busy hospital. My life there is quite stressful because I always get up very early and I hardly ever have time for a long lunch. However, this month my situation is very different.

Right now, I am volunteering for a humanitarian project in a small village in Kenya. At this moment, we are building a new sustainable school for the local children. Today, the sun is shining intensely and the temperature is rising. My colleagues are not resting; they are preparing medical supplies for the afternoon clinic.

The local people are very welcoming. They don't have many possessions, but they share everything generously. I understand their language a bit better now because I am studying Swahili every evening. I believe this experience is changing my life. Are you thinking about joining a charity project one day?
